Indica, sativa and hybrid are a retail shopping convention — not a reliable guide to genetics or effects. When researchers analysed 89,923 commercial samples across six states, these labels did not predict a plant’s terpene or cannabinoid profile, and a genome-wide study found sativa- and indica-labelled plants to be genetically indistinct (PLOS ONE 2022; Nature Plants 2021). The labels are so fluid that AK-47, a hybrid, won “Best Sativa” at the 1999 Cannabis Cup and “Best Indica” four years later. For an accurate, genetics-true picture, see the chemotype above.

About Gulf Breeze
Gulf Breeze this is an amazing cultivar created after hunting through several pheno’s of Mimosa x Orange Punch from Barney’s Farm and choosing that special one that stood out above all of the others to cross with with a super stud of Orange Daiquiri. This is a THC dominant cultivar that has tested 27-31%. She has a very orange and citrus profile, coming through with hints of lemon and lime. The effects come on very strong as it creeps up on you sending your mind soaring like being lifted into the clouds full of ideas this is a great daytime cultivar
